The key regions like North America, Europe, Asia-Pacific, Central & South America, Middle East and Africa etc. Auxiliary Power Units (APUs) are gas turbine engines used primarily during aircraft ground operation to provide electricity, compressed air, and/or shaft power for main engine start, air conditioning, electric power and other aircraft systems. APUs can also provide backup electric power during in-flight operation. The aircraft APU provides power to start the main engines. Turbine engines compressors must be turned to a significant speed for self-sustaining operation. Before the engines are to be turned, the APU is started, generally by a battery or hydraulic accumulator. Once the APU is running, it provides power (electric, pneumatic, or hydraulic, depending on the design) to start the aircraft's main engines. Geographically, the consumption market is leading by North America and Europe, sales in Asia Pacific regions like China, Japan, Southeast Asia and India will see significant growth in future period. North America holds the largest market share, with about 1264 Units sold in 2017, followed by Europe, with about 38.45% market share.
